On Saturday, future President Donald Trump announced Kash Patel would lead the FBI. On Sunday, current President Joe Biden pardoned his son Hunter. Coincidence? The Washington Post’s Matt Viser and The Atlantic’s Elaina Plott Calabro explain. This episode was produced by Miles Bryan and Amanda Lewellyn, edited by Matt Collette, fact-checked by Kim Eggleston, engineered by Patrick Boyd and Rob Byers, and hosted by Sean Rameswaram.
